Multi Sports Day for Students with Disabilities

Over 200 students from 13 Schools attended the Multi Sport Day at Penrith Sports and Basketball Stadium conducted by the Office of Sport and Recreation and their School Sport Unit.

Students, teachers and carers had the opportunity to partake in 10 different sports across the venue.

It was no surprise in the heartland of Western Sydney that football was a popular choice for participants.

Football NSW Member Services Manager, Matt Rippon and Game Development Officer, Demelza Howard took the opportunity to promote the sport and its Football4All programs to the participants looking ahead to 2017 as programs and participation numbers again look set to grow.

Howard was delighted with the promotion the day received.

“It was a fantastic day with numerous students excited to participate in football.

“Plenty of goals were scored with high fives and smiles present throughout the day.”

Football NSW will again have a presence with upcoming Multi Sport Days in Lennox Head and Wollongong as well as the Wheelchair NSW Expo at Barangaroo on September 11 and 12.
